Linking a PreSet Position to yourRemote Control or Intelligent AccessKey Fob
Your vehicle can save the preset memorypositions for up to two remote controls orintelligent access (IA) keys.
After you have saved your desired memorypreset positions:
1.Press and hold the desired preset buttonfor about three seconds until you hear asingle tone.
2. Within three seconds, press the lockbutton on the remote control you arelinking.
To unlink a remote control, follow the sameprocedure – except in step 2, press theunlock button on the remote control.
Note:If more than one linked remote controlor intelligent access key is in range, thememory function moves to the settings ofthe first key to initiate a memory recall.
Easy Entry and Exit Feature
If you enable the easy entry and exit feature,it automatically moves the driver seatposition rearward up to 2 in (5 cm) when youswitch the ignition off.
The driver seat returns to the previousposition when you switch the ignition on.
You can enable or disable this feature in theinformation display. See GeneralInformation (page 110).

Programming to a Genie Intellicode 2Garage Door Opener
Note:The Genie Intellicode 2 transmittermust already be programmed to operatewith the garage door opener.
Note:To program HomeLink to thetransmitter you must first put the transmitterinto programming mode.
Red indicator lightA.
Green indicator lightB.
1.Press and hold one of the buttons on thehand-held transmitter for 10 seconds. Theindicator light will change from green tored and green.
2. Press the same button twice to confirmthe change to programming mode. Ifdone properly the indicator light willappear red.
3. Hold the transmitter within 1–3 in(2–8 cm) of the button on the visor youwant to program.
4. Press and hold both the programmedGenie button on the hand-heldtransmitter and the button you want toprogram. The indicator light on the visorwill flash rapidly when the programmingis successful.
Note:The Genie transmitter will transmit forup to 30 seconds. If HomeLink does notprogram within 30 seconds the Genietransmitter will need to be pressed again. Ifthe Genie transmitter indicator light displaysgreen and red, release the button until theindicator light turns off before pressing thebutton again.
Once HomeLink has been programmedsuccessfully, the Genie transmitter must bechanged out of program mode. To do this:
1. Press and hold the previouslyprogrammed Genie button on thehand-held transmitter for 10 seconds. Theindicator light will change from red to redand green.
2. Press the same button twice to confirmthe change. If done correctly the indicatorlight will turn green.

STARTING A HYBRID ELECTRIC
VEHICLE SYSTEM
When the engine starts for the first time onyour drive, the idle speed increases, thishelps to warm up the engine. If the engineidle speed does not slow down automatically,have your vehicle checked by an authorizeddealer.
Note: You can crank the engine for a totalof 60 seconds without the engine startingbefore the starting system temporarilydisables. The 60 seconds does not have tobe all at once. For example, if you crank theengine three times for 20 seconds each time,without the engine starting, you reached the60-second time limit. A message appearsin the information display alerting you thatyou exceeded the cranking time. Youcannot attempt to start the engine for atleast 15 minutes.
Note: After 15 minutes, you are limited to a15-second engine cranking time. You needto wait 60 minutes before you can crank theengine for 60 seconds again.
Before starting your vehicle, check thefollowing:
•Make sure all occupants have fastenedtheir seatbelts.
•Make sure the headlamps and electricalaccessories are off.
•Make sure the parking brake is on.
•Put the transmission in P.
Note:Do not touch the accelerator pedal.
1. Fully depress the brake pedal.
2. Press the button.
Note:The green ready indicator illuminatesletting you know that your vehicle is readyfor driving. Since your vehicle is equippedwith a silent key start, the engine may notstart when your vehicle starts. See HybridVehicle Operation (page 171).

Fast Restart
The fast restart feature allows you to restartyour vehicle within 20 seconds of switchingit off, even if it does not detect a validpassive key.
Within 20 seconds of switching your vehicleoff, press the brake pedal and press thebutton. After 20 seconds, you can no longerstart your vehicle if it does not detect a validpassive key.
Once your vehicle starts, it remains runninguntil you press the button, even if yourvehicle does not detect a valid passive key.If you open and close a door while yourvehicle is running, the system searches fora valid passive key. You cannot start yourvehicle if the system does not detect a validpassive key within 20 seconds.
Automatic Shutdown
This feature automatically shuts down yourvehicle if it has been idling for an extendedperiod. The ignition also turns off in order tosave battery power. Before your vehicleshuts down, a message appears in theinformation display showing a timer counting
down from 30 seconds. If you do notintervene within 30 seconds, your vehicleshuts down. Another message appears inthe information display to inform you thatyour vehicle has shut down in order to savefuel. Start your vehicle as you normally do.
Automatic Shutdown Override
Note:You cannot permanently switch off theautomatic shutdown feature. When youswitch it off temporarily, it turns on at thenext ignition cycle.
You can stop the shutdown, or reset thetimer, at any point before the 30-secondcountdown has expired by doing any of thefollowing:

Switching Off Your Vehicle When It IsStationary
1. Put the transmission in position P.
2. Press the button once.
3. Apply the parking brake.
Note:This switches off the ignition, allelectrical circuits, warning lamps andindicators.
Note:If your vehicle is left running for 30minutes without any interaction, itautomatically shuts down.
Switching Off Your Vehicle When It IsMoving
WARNING: Switching off the enginewhen your vehicle is still moving results in asignificant decrease in braking assistance.Higher effort is required to apply the brakesand to stop your vehicle. A significantdecrease in steering assistance could alsooccur. The steering does not lock, but highereffort could be required to steer your vehicle.When you switch the ignition off, someelectrical circuits, for example airbags, alsoturn off. If you unintentionally switch theignition off, shift into neutral (N) and restartthe engine.
1. Put the transmission in position N anduse the brakes to bring your vehicle to asafe stop.
2. When your vehicle has stopped, put thetransmission in position P.
3. Press and hold the button for onesecond, or press it three times within twoseconds.
4. Apply the parking brake.

During certain events (such as vehicleservicing) your low voltage 12-volt batterymay become disconnected or disabled. Oncethe battery is reconnected and after drivingthe vehicle, the engine may continue tooperate for three to five seconds after thekey is turned to off. This is a normalcondition.
Braking:
Your hybrid is equipped with standardhydraulic braking and regenerative braking.Regenerative braking is performed by yourtransmission and it captures brake energyand stores it in your high voltage battery.
Driving to Optimize Fuel Economy
Note:Having your engine running is notalways an indication of inefficiency. In somecases, it is actually more efficient thandriving in electric mode.
Your fuel economy should improvethroughout your hybrid's break-in period. Aswith any vehicle, your driving habits andaccessory usage can significantly impactyour fuel economy. For best results, keep inmind these tips:
•Keep the tires properly inflated and onlyuse the recommended size.
•Aggressive driving increases the amountof energy required to move your vehicle.In general, you can achieve better fueleconomy with mild to moderateacceleration and deceleration. Moderatebraking is particularly important since itallows you to maximize the energycaptured by the regenerative brakingsystem.
Additional Tips:
•Do not carry extra loads.
•Be mindful of adding externalaccessories that may increaseaerodynamic drag.
•Observe posted speed limits.
•Perform all scheduled maintenance.
•There is no need to wait for your engineto warm up. The vehicle is ready to driveimmediately after starting.
ECOSELECT
EcoSelect is a drive mode for non plug-invehicles designed to offer the best possiblefuel economy with tradeoffs in vehicleperformance and comfort.
To switch EcoSelect on, press theECO button.
A graphic displays on your informationdisplay when EcoSelect is on.
Your vehicle will remember the last selectedmode whenever you start your vehicle.
EcoSelect allows your vehicle to operatemore efficiently. You will notice:
•Less aggressive cooling.
•Softer acceleration.
•Increased deceleration when coasting.

FUEL CONSUMPTION
Advertised Capacity
The advertised capacity is the maximumamount of fuel that you can add to the fueltank after running out of fuel. Included in theadvertised capacity is an empty reserve. Theempty reserve is an unspecified amount offuel that remains in the fuel tank when thefuel gauge indicates empty.
Note:The amount of fuel in the emptyreserve varies and should not be relied uponto increase driving range.
Fuel Economy
Your vehicle calculates fuel economy figuresthrough the trip computer average fuelfunction. See General Information (page110).
The first 1,000 mi (1,500 km) of driving is thebreak-in period of the engine. A moreaccurate measurement is obtained after2,000 mi (3,000 km).

Understanding the Positions of yourElectronic Transmission
Note:Always come to a complete stopbefore putting your vehicle into and out ofpark (P).
Putting your vehicle in gear:
1. Fully press down the brake pedal.
2. Press and release the button on theinstrument panel of the gear you want toselect.
3. The gear shift button you selectilluminates and the instrument clustershows the selected gear.
4. Release the brake pedal and yourtransmission remains in the selectedgear.
Note:If the driver attempts to leave thevehicle when it is in gear, the vehicleautomatically shifts into park (P). Seatbeltand door monitors determine the driver'sintent and makes the shift for you. Duringthis time a Transmission not in Parkmessage appears in the display screen,prompting the driver to make the shift. Toput the vehicle in gear with the door openperform steps 1-4. See the Automatic Returnto Park section in this chapter for moreinformation on this feature.
Note:To put your vehicle in gear with thedoor open, perform steps 1-4. See theAutomatic Return to Park section in thischapter for more information on this feature.
Park (P)
This position locks the transmission andprevents the front wheels from turning.Always come to a complete stop beforeputting your vehicle into and out of park (P).An audible chime sounds when park (P) ismanually selected.
When you turn the ignition off, your vehicleautomatically shifts into park (P). If you turnthe ignition off when your vehicle is moving,it first shifts into neutral (N) until a slowenough speed is reached. Your vehicle thenshifts into park (P) automatically.
